Useful Tips For A Peaceful Sleep At Night

Do you often find yourself in the morning waking up exhausted? I won't be surprised if most of you say ‘yes' to this question. Ultimately, it all boils down to having a proper sleep in the night to make your morning feel fresher and better. This is not only a problem for the working men or women but also for the house wives. They get tensed about all the stuff like making lunch in the morning, at what time they have to be somewhere tomorrow and all the little things. The best way to get rid of that really is that when you have a lot of things dancing in your head when you go to sleep then you are not going to get sleep. Make it to do less. Try to get it out of your head. Write all the things that come to your mind in a piece of paper. By transferring the thoughts into something physical you get to lose a lot of stress.

All these don't do any good to your sleep. The drink will help you fall asleep but it won't help you stay asleep. Some people have the habit of watching comedy shows or reading fashion magazines to fall asleep. But still these activities when done before bed time stay in your memory. It will not prevent you from thinking or talking about it. Instead, you may try and do activities that kind of help you relax your body and mind. You may do laundry; arrange the things in your room, or even a warm bath. These things will gradually help your body to wind down and get the stress out of your mind.

Studies have shown that more than men, only women have the problem of not getting a good night's sleep. Well there are a lot of reasons for that. For example, menopause or pregnancy and other hormonal things will work against your sleep. In some cases a lack of sleep could also be as a result of other physical ailments like asthma, high blood pressure or any other chronic illness. So the best thing you can do is to check with your doctor if you have troubles sleeping for more than three or four nights a week. In case you have some important work the next morning and you have to desperately get a good night's sleep then you may go for a mild dose of sleeping pills but even this should be done only after consulting with your doctor. Remember, having pharmaceutical solutions are not harmful if taken occasionally may be like once a month or so. Nevertheless, if you make it a habit to take sleeping pills every night then it could lead to a lot of other health problems.

Ultimately, getting a good night's sleep boils down to be cool in the evening even if not in the daytime. Nevertheless, it is easier said than done. Make sure that you are working during the day to get some good sleep in the night. Do some exercise (but not close to bed time), get some daylight, don't have caffeine after 5pm. Try to go to bed at the same time every night and try to wake up in the morning in the same time every day even during the weekends. You can't be careless about your habits! That's about it.
